> Trying to make fio on redhat 5.9 results in:
> 
>     lex: unknown flag '-'.  For usage, try
>             lex --help
>     make: *** [lex.yy.c] Error 1
> 
> Changeset "c9fa1c8d (Stephen M. Cameron  2014-10-06 17:58:32 -0500
> 270)" introduced the lex '--header-file' option, but that option is
> not valid on redhat 5.
> 
> Makefile diff...
> 
>      ifdef CONFIG_ARITHMETIC
>      lex.yy.c: exp/expression-parser.l
>     -       $(QUIET_LEX)$(LEX) exp/expression-parser.l
>     +       $(QUIET_LEX)$(LEX) --header-file=lexer.h exp/expression-parser.l

Stephen, ideas on how to work around this? Would be nice if we could
make-do without the lexer.h generation. Unfortunately I don't have a
RHEL5 here.

Tim, what does lex --version and flex --version say?
